Polaris 280 Exploded Parts Diagram: A Polaris 280 exploded parts diagram is a detailed illustration that shows the individual components of the Polaris 280 automatic pool cleaner in a disassembled state. It provides a comprehensive overview of the cleaner’s internal structure, including its motor, pump, filter, and drive system.
Importance and Benefits: Exploded parts diagrams are essential for understanding the assembly, disassembly, and repair of complex machines like the Polaris 280. They enable technicians and DIY enthusiasts to identify individual components, locate faults, and visualize the relationships between different parts. This information is crucial for troubleshooting, maintenance, and ensuring the optimal performance of the pool cleaner.
